  • Patent number: 5036393
    Abstract: In, for example, a motion compensated video standards converter blocks in a first field or frame of a video signal are each compared with a plurality of blocks in the next succeeding field or frame of the video signal for deriving motion vectors representing the motion of the content of respective blocks between the first field or frame and the next field or frame, motion vectors are allocated to each pixel of each field or frame, the allocated motion vectors are checked to identify spurious motion vectors by comparing the allocated motion vectors with motion vectors allocated to adjacent pixels, and spurious motion vectors so identified are replaced by motion vectors allocated to adjacent pixels.
    Type: Grant
    Filed: April 20, 1990
    Date of Patent: July 30, 1991
    Assignee: Sony Corporation
    Inventors: Raphael Samad, John W. Richards, Carl W. Walters
  • Patent number: 5027205
    Abstract: In, for example, a motion compensated video standards converter wherein blocks in a first field or frame of a video signal are each compared with a plurality of blocks in the following succeeding field or frame of the video signal for deriving motion vectors representing the motion of the content of respective blocks between the first field or frame and the following field or frame, and wherein a respective correlation surface is generated for blocks in the first field or frame, the correlation surface representing the difference between the content of the block in the first field or frame and the content of each block in the following field or frame with which it has been compared, the shape of that part of the correlation surface which represents differences less than a threshold level is determined, and the comparison is varied in dependence on the shape.
    Type: Grant
    Filed: April 20, 1990
    Date of Patent: June 25, 1991
    Assignee: Sony Corporation
    Inventors: Richard J. A. Avis, Clive H. Gillard, Raphael Samad
  • Patent number: 5027203
    Abstract: In, for example, a motion compensated video standards converter wherein blocks in a first field or frame of a video signal are each compared with a plurality of blocks in the following field or frame of the video signal for deriving motion vectors representing the motion of the content of respective blocks between the first field or frame and the following field or frame, further motion vectors are selected for assignment to those of the blocks for which less than a predetermined plurality of good motion vectors are derived as a result of the comparison, by ranking all the good, non-stationary motion vectors derived for the field or frame in order of frequency of occurrence, and selecting those motion vectors which occur most frequently, unless they fall within a predetermined window of pixel motion of a motion vector already selected.
    Type: Grant
    Filed: April 20, 1990
    Date of Patent: June 25, 1991
    Assignee: Sony Corporation
    Inventors: Raphael Samad, John W. Richards, Clive H. Gillard
  • Patent number: 5016101
    Abstract: Apparatus for converting a video signal to a photographic film image comprises a television standards converter for deriving from an input video signal, which may be a high definition video signal, a motion compensated digital video signal corresponding to 24 progressive scan frames per second, a video signal recorder for recording the digital video signal, a digital-to-analog converter for converting the digital video signal after reproduction to an analog video signal corresponding to 24 progressive scan frames per second, and an electron beam recorder to which the analog video signal is applied to record the content of the analog video signal on photographic film.
    Type: Grant
    Filed: April 20, 1990
    Date of Patent: May 14, 1991
    Assignee: Sony Corporation
    Inventors: John W. Richards, Clive H. Gillard, Richard J. A. Avis, Raphael Samad, Carl W. Walters

  • Patent number: 4992869
    Abstract: In, for example, a motion compensated video standards converter blocks in a first field or frame of a video signal are each compared with a plurality of blocks in the following field or frame of the video signal for deriving motion vectors representing the motion of the content of respective blocks between the first field or frame and the following field or frame, a correlation surface is generated for respective blocks in the first field or frame, the correlation surface representing the difference between the content of the block in the first field or frame and the content of each block in the following field or frame with which it has been compared, the correlation surface is tested for a clear minimum, the size of the blocks is increased to generate new correlation surfaces, each new correlation surface is tested for a clear minimum, and motion vectors are derived in dependence on the clearest minimum so found.
    Type: Grant
    Filed: April 20, 1990
    Date of Patent: February 12, 1991
    Assignee: Sony Corporation
    Inventors: Raphael Samad, John W. Richards
